VIN: 1FAFP42X1XF138246

World Manufacturer Identifier - 1st, 2nd, 3rd Positions
VIN Code: 1FA
Assembly Country: USA
Make: Ford
Body Style: Coupe
Restraint System Type (Passenger Cars) or Brake Type and GVWR Class (Trucks and Vans) - 4th Position
VIN Code: F
Restraint: BELT, ACTIVE, AIRBAG
Line,Series Body Type - 5th, 6th, 7th Positions
VIN Code: P42
Vehicle Line: Mustang
Series: GT
Vehicle Type: Car/Minivan
Engine Type - 8th Position
VIN Code: X
Engine: 4.6 L
Cylinders: 8
Fuel: Gasoline
Horsepower: 225 HORSEPOWER
Model Year - 10th Position
VIN Code: X
Model Year: 1999
Assembly Plant - 11th Position
VIN Code: F
Assembly Plant: DEARBORN: DEARBORN, MI
Production Sequence Number - 12th - 17th
VIN Code: 138246
Prod Sequence Number 138246
 
Voorhee's chimes in on the 35th anniv.site(special production) He gan give you the sequence number if you car is a 35th anniv. LIMITED EDITION. not if it is just a 99,which all were 35th anniv. cars
 
I guess what i'm asking is my car is what number out of 18,907 Crystal White GT's in 1999.


From the looks of your avatar, your car isn't a 35th anniversary edition. I don't see the hood scoop or black out hood decal.

Ford doesn't keep sequential numbers on non-cobras anyway.

Hate to break it to ya, but you just have 1 of 19,000 white GT's made that year.
 
Maples,

Sent you a PM, but everyone here is correct. Not all 1999 Mustangs with the 35th badge are "Limited Editions". I do have an Excel file with VIN's on just those 4,628 GT's.
